How much do senior software eng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ior software engineer in Miami, FL is $136,835.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$117,000.00 and $154,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a senior software engineer?

A senior software engineer designs, codes, tests, and maintains computer software. While these are your primary responsibilities as a senior software engineer, you may also have supervisory duties. These include overseeing a team of junior software engineers or developers. The senior software engineer title is sometimes used interchangeably with senior developer, and positions for both may share similar job duties and responsibilities. In general, software engineers are distinguished from developers in that software engineers apply engineering principles to software development.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ior software eng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Software Engineer, you need advanced programming skills, deep understanding of software architecture, and several years of experience in software development, often supported by a relevant degree. Familiarity with tools like Git, CI/CD pipelines, cloud platforms, and expertise in technologies such as Java, Python, or JavaScript are typically required. Leadership, problem-solving, and effective communication are crucial soft skills for mentoring teams and collaborating across departments. These skills ensure the delivery of robust, scalable solutions and drive successful project outcomes in complex technical environments.

What are some common challenges senior software engineers face when mentoring junior team members?

Senior Software Engineers often mentor junior colleagues, which can be incredibly rewarding but also presents challenges. Balancing mentorship with project deadlines can be demanding, as it requires strong time management and communication skills. Additionally, adapting explanations to different learning styles and levels of experience can be tricky. However, effective mentorship helps build a stronger team and can lead to enhanced leadership opportunities for the senior engineer.

How Youโ€™ll Contribute
  • Kaufman Rossin is seeking a Senior Software Engineer to join our growing Information Technology team.
  • In this role, youโ€™ll help shape the future of KRโ€™s application portfolio by delivering high quality features, modernizing legacy services, reducing technical debt, and standardizing development tools and practices.
  • Youโ€™ll work across WES, including WES API, WES UI, Hermes, and Workstreams, and collaborate closely with KRโ€™s global delivery team in Bengaluru.
  • Build and maintain production features across WES API using Python and FastAPI, WES UI using React and TypeScript, Hermes, and Workstreams
  • Develop business logic and AI workflows using Python and FastAPI
  • Contribute to systems and performance critical components using Rust, Axum, and Tonic
  • Build reusable React components using the selected component library, including Tailwind with Radix or Fluent UI
  • Use React Query for server state and Zustand for client state while supporting the migration from legacy Apollo and Redux patterns
  • Implement real time functionality using Azure SignalR Service
  • Develop event driven solutions using Azure Event Hubs and Kafka compatible messaging patterns
  • Integrate applications with Azure Entra ID using OAuth 2.0, OpenID Connect, and JWT standards
  • Technology Consolidation & Tech Debt Reduction
  • Assess technical debt, document effort and risk, and develop phased migration plans that minimize production disruption
  • Support the migration of AWS workloads to Azure, including EKS to AKS and Cognito to Entra ID
  • Help reduce KRโ€™s language and framework footprint by transitioning Ruby, Go, Node.js, Express.js, and Ember.js services toward Python, Rust, and React standards
  • Consolidate observability tools into Azure Monitor, Application Insights, and Azure Managed Grafana
  • Consolidate security tools using GitHub Advanced Security, Microsoft Defender for Cloud, and Azure Key Vault
  • Contribute to retrieval augmented generation technology decisions involving Azure AI Search, HelixDB, and TensorZero
  • Code Quality & Engineering Standards
  • Native testing per active language: pytest (Python), vitest/Jest (TypeScript/JS), cargo test/criterion/proptest (Rust)
  • Native linting per active language: ruff (Python), ESLint (TS/JS), clippy (Rust)
  • Author and enforce ADRs โ€” document technology choices, migration decisions, and trade-offs
  • Maintain CI/CD pipelines in GitHub Actions (or Azure DevOps Pipelines where applicable)
  • Global Delivery Team Partnership
  • Work as a true partner with KR's Bengaluru development team
  • Participate in cross-regional agile ceremonies: standups, sprint planning, reviews, retrospectives
  • Produce developer-facing documentation: ADRs, API references, runbooks, migration playbooks
  • Mentor less-experienced developers on the global team: code reviews, architecture Q&A, knowledge transfer
  • AI-Integrated Application Development
  • Integrate AI capabilities into WES, building on Azure AI Search + HelixDB + TensorZero gateway for document intelligence and semantic search
  • Contribute to prompt engineering and retrieval optimization within the application layer
  • Build React components, API endpoints, and streaming response handlers that surface AI features reliably
How Youโ€™ll Stand Out
  • 5+ years production software development experience Strong Python: FastAPI, async patterns, pytest, ruff โ€” production API development
  • Strong TypeScript/React: component design, React Query, Zustand, vitest/Jest, ESLint Working Rust: able to read, extend, and contribute to axum/tonic services; clippy fluency
  • Event-driven architecture like Kafka
  • Identity/auth systems: OAuth2/OIDC, JWT, Azure Entra ID or equivalent
  • Demonstrated technical debt reduction โ€” structured migration planning and measurable consolidation
